技术文摘
JavaScript 中怎样简洁地将多个变量初始化为 null
JavaScript 中怎样简洁地将多个变量初始化为 null
在JavaScript编程中,经常会遇到需要将多个变量初始化为null的情况。这在初始化对象属性、清理变量引用或者准备重新赋值时非常常见。下面将介绍几种简洁的方法来实现这一操作。
传统逐个赋值法
最基本的方法就是逐个将变量赋值为null。例如:
let var1 = null;
let var2 = null;
let var3 = null;
这种方法简单直接,但当变量数量较多时,代码会显得冗长且重复。
使用数组解构赋值
如果变量是一组有规律的变量集合,可以利用数组解构赋值来简洁地初始化。例如:
let [var1, var2, var3] = [null, null, null];
这种方式比逐个赋值要简洁一些,尤其适用于变量数量相对固定且较少的情况。
对象解构赋值
当需要初始化的变量是对象的属性时,对象解构赋值是一个不错的选择。例如:
let { prop1, prop2, prop3 } = { prop1: null, prop2: null, prop3: null };
这种方法在处理对象属性初始化时非常方便,代码结构清晰。
使用循环初始化
如果有大量的变量需要初始化,可以使用循环来实现。例如,将一组变量存储在一个数组中,然后通过循环遍历数组并将每个元素赋值为null:
let variables = [var1, var2, var3];
for (let i = 0; i < variables.length; i++) {
variables[i] = null;
}
这种方法适用于变量数量较多且有一定规律的情况,可以减少代码的重复编写。
结合函数封装
为了进一步提高代码的复用性,可以将初始化变量的操作封装成一个函数。例如:
function initVariables() {
let var1 = null;
let var2 = null;
let var3 = null;
return { var1, var2, var3 };
}
let { var1, var2, var3 } = initVariables();
这样,在需要初始化这些变量的地方,只需要调用这个函数即可。
在JavaScript中,有多种方法可以简洁地将多个变量初始化为null。根据具体的需求和变量的特点,选择合适的方法可以提高代码的可读性和可维护性。
TAGS: 简洁方法 JavaScript变量初始化 多个变量初始化 初始化为null
- 从 MVC 到 DDD 架构的本质探究
- 六款让你爱不释手的 IDEA 神仙插件,开发效率狂飙
- 深度剖析 ASP.NET Core Identity 的模块设计
- Python 面向对象编程进阶知识深度解析助你提升
- Go 中“哨兵错误”的由来与使用建议
- 你是否知晓有哪些静态代码检查工具?
- 彻底搞懂 Golang 中的指针
- SPACE 框架对开发者生产力的提升
- Monorepos 虽痛苦 但这些工具让工作变轻松
- B 端软件常见知识汇总
- GitHub 获 2.2k 星!多模态大语言模型首篇综述 论文列表实时更新
- 共话并发编程之同步工具类
- 15 个必知的 Javascript 数组方法
- 微服务架构概述
- TypeScript 中类型保护的五种使用方法